Andica
Self Assessment software supports the Inland
Revenue's main tax return form SA100 with the most
common supplementary forms you might need, dependent
on your circumstances. In all, Andica Self Assessment
software provides the following forms.
SA 100 - Main Tax Return pages
SA 101 - Employment
SA 101M - Ministers of Religion
SA 102 - Share Schemes
SA 103 - Self Employment
SA 103L - Lloyds Underwriters
SA 104 - Partnership short version
SA 104F - Partnership full version
SA 105 - Land & Property
SA 106 - Foreign
SA 107 - Trusts
SA 108 - Capital Gains Tax
SA 109 - Non-residence
Inland Revenue notes for the forms are
provided with the software along with the SA150 Tax return
guide and SA151 Tax Calculation Guide.
Online submission
With Andica
Self Assessment software you can complete and submit
your tax return electronically to the Inland Revenue
via the Government Gateway using a File By Internet
feature. You will need a prior registration with the
Inland Revenue who will provide you with a User ID
and Pin Code.
